Flames’ Smid leaves game after hit by Despres

Calgary’s Ladislav Smid would leave the game after taking this it to the head from Pittsburgh’s Simon Despres.

Calgary Flames defenceman Ladislav Smid was forced to leave Friday’s game after being on the receiving end of a hard hit from Simon Despres of the Pittsburgh Penguins.

Late in the second period, Depres landed the hit in the Penguins’ zone as Smid went to play the puck. The Flames announced Smid would not return to the game with what they’re calling an “upper-body injury.”

Depres was not penalized on the play.
